How to Use AI Online Help

 A screenshot of a computerAI-generated content may be incorrect.

The user flow for AI Online Help:

  1. Select documentation version. Choose the version that matches your environment or needs.
  2. Enter your question and click Send. If you want to query the Rest API, enable the Ask From NetBrain Rest API checkbox before sending.
  3. View the answer and if you would like more details, click the reference link included in the response.
  4. (Optional) Ask a follow-up question. Continue the conversation to get more clarification or deeper insights.

To start a completely new topic, click New Chat to enter a new question.

For other resources:

  • Click NetBrain Document to open the original help document for the selected version.
  • Click NetBrain University to access training videos and learning materials.
